U17 Women’s World Cup — Ghana’s Black Maidens Trash Hosts Uruguay 5-0 In Opening Game

blank

The national female U-17 football team, the Black Maidens, had the best of starts to the 2018 Fifa U-17 Women’s World Cup, which is currently ongoing in the South American country of Uruguay.

Facing the hosts in their opening game, our ladies were unfazed and spanked Uruguay by an impressive 5-0 scoreline.

France Dispatches Uruguay 2-0 To Become First Team To Reach 2018 World Cup Semis

blank

blank
The French national team brushed aside South American powerhouses Uruguay in the first 2018 world cup quarter finals to become the first side to reach the semi finals of the competition.
Raphael Varane and Antoine Griezmann scored in either half to guide their team to a comfortable win over a Cavani-less Uruguay.

I Collapsed After Gyan's Penalty Miss In 2010 World Cup – Richard Kingson

Legendary Black Stars goalie Richard ‘Olele’ Kingson has revealed that he literally fainted in 2010 after Asamoah Gyan missed that infamous penalty for Ghana against Uruguay.
The Black Stars earned a last minute penalty against the South American side after Luis Suarez handled Dominic Adiyiah’s header on the line, but Gyan missed the resulting spot kick.
